Well last run didn't go as anticipated, though people put in a good effort. I believe that we made some mistakes in all three zones, however, and feel that we had the correct setups for the most part to win all three.
NW: I talked to Heie about what went wrong, and it seems that either the Faf fight needs to be sped up, or needs to be skipped. A bad wipe at the end of the run killed their time remaining, but that's avoidable and not a deal-breaker if the first point is addressed.
NE: Honestly, there's no excuse for us losing, literally. We had a wipe at the portal, and the mobs unexpectedly did not reset. We didn't realize why (they were glitching and aggroing the people on the next floor) until we had already used our RR. I don't think anything needs to be changed for this zone.
SW: Miscommunications and a bad wipe at the start caused the problems here. One thing to make sure of on ALL runs: make sure someone with reraise on is the last person up the vortex/portal. Never leave someone without RR when going up a floor, cause you can't get back to raise em if they die. I also feel like this zone could benefit from a seventh man moreso than NE, so I will probly move one person over to this area.
All-in-all, people did well, and I'm starting to see more people pop up as leaders. This is probably the most important variable for split-runs to be successful... I can handle the zone I'm in, but I need other people to know what to do in the other zones so they can manage on their own. We'll try all three again on Thurs assuming we have similar numbers!
